AEG fuses quetion
 
Whats the recommended fuse for a 8.4v and a 9.6v battery? (large)

ILLusion April 16th, 2007 01:05

That depends more on your spring, your gears and your motor.

But stock is 15A.

I run some setups using a 9.6v battery with a 15A fuse, still. I've only popped a 15A fuse once, and that was with a 480fps gearbox.

Spa April 16th, 2007 01:09

torque up gears M120 or M100, and stock motor

ILLusion April 16th, 2007 01:10

Just keep it at stock 15A. If it pops, then move up in 5A increments till it stops popping.

But if it's popping with that setup, you should look at your shimming job. It could be a bit too tight.

Spa April 16th, 2007 02:42

hmm, i jsut did the shims and they move perfectly. they dont jump and when i spin them they spin with no friction at all.

ILLusion April 16th, 2007 03:59

Then move up to a 20A fuse. It's not a bad thing to do... but it just means that the higher the current draw, the less efficient the system is.
